The Judge is a revolver manufactured by Taurus that is designed to chamber both .45 Colt cartridges and .410 bore shotgun shells. This unique feature allows it to function as both a handgun and a short-range shotgun, making it popular for self-defense and home protection. The Judge is known for its versatility and effectiveness at close range, particularly with the use of shotgun shells. Its distinctive design and capabilities have made it a notable choice among firearm enthusiasts.
